We can also convert 1967-1973 non-tach harnesses to a tach configuration. How We Do It: Every harness is examined for broken insulation, wires, connectors, and pins, and repaired using only OEM components and professional tooling. Every harness is cleaned and re-taped where appropriate. Every wire is checked for continuity and any wire run showing higher than expected resistance is repaired. Repairs are typically made using uninsulated butt-splices and covered with heat-shrink, in accordance with best practices in the electrical repair industry. What Comes With Service: Every harness comes with a new set of fuses, a complete printout of each wire's connector type, wire color, wire number, function, and where that wire goes within the harness, an instruction sheet for short-free installation, and a two year, no questions asked, guaranty. We prefer to refurbish your harness instead of replacing it with an existing one; this insures your harness will have the necessary connections for your set of equipment options. Why Do We Do This: The cost of quality reproduction underdash harnesses is risen to unprecedented levels. While the quality of reproduction is excellent, the average hobbyist has little alternative but to repair an existing harness or go to others who offer concours level harness restoration services. Our harnesses are guaranteed to meet or exceed the original performance specifications, but may have visual flaws when compared to concours-level restoration efforts. These flaws typically include splices with shrink-tubing that may be visible. However, all wiring, when installed correctly, cannot be seen by a Judge without extraordinary effort.
